If your other unit gets that channel, does a PV roll, and the GTM unit does not, it is likely that the GTM does not have the needed EMM key.
Look in the other unit for those EMM keys and add them to the GTM unit.
GTM units hide their EMM keys in the software.
If not search online for a EMM key for that channel.
